Persian language and identity have been a rich part of humanity since pre-historic times.\u00a0 Ancient Greece traded with the Persians, and Alexander the Great conquered them. \u00a0The Persians never became Christianized, for they already had their own monotheistic Zoroastrian religion. \u00a0The 7<sup>th<\/sup> century explosion of Arab enthusiasm and Islamic expansionism overwhelmed the \u2018known world\u2019 from Spain to Afghanistan. Islam became dominant in Persia. \u00a0In the 13<sup>th<\/sup> century, the equally explosive expansion of Genghis Khan\u2019s Turco-Mongol empire once again threatened Persian language and identity, giving rise to the 500-year dominance of the Sunni Muslim Ottoman Empire.<\/p>\n<p>Shia Muslims follow the descendants of Caliph Ali\u2019s union with the Prophet Mohamed&#8217;s daughter Fatima, and the succession of Twelve Imams. The twelfth and last Shia Imam disappeared in 873 leaving no offspring. \u00a0Feeling squeezed between Arab and Turkish powers, around 1501 Shah Ismail I of the Safavid dynasty decided to reinforce Persian identity by adopting the Shia version of Islam, resisting the dominant Sunni orthodoxy imposed by the Umayyad Arabs who had killed the Caliph Ali and his sons.<\/p>\n<p>Freed from the Ottomans in 1920, Persia was now squeezed by Western Capitalists.
